A platform designed to connect junior designers with top tech companies by having them complete design assignments. The platform promised feedback and would forward the best submissions to its network, aiming to facilitate hiring for emerging talent.
Opportunity3.2
Why now
General need for talent acquisition and career development, but market conditions (deteriorating market, tech layoffs) made companies less willing to pay for junior talent access.
Market gap
Believed to address the gap in junior designers getting noticed and companies vetting junior talent effectively, but primary hypothesis on talent quality and willingness to pay was disproven.
